@Generated(value="software.amazon.awssdk:codegen") public final class CreatePartnerEventSourceRequest extends EventBridgeRequest implements ToCopyableBuilder<CreatePartnerEventSourceRequest.Builder,CreatePartnerEventSourceRequest>
Modifier and Type | Class and Description |
---|---|
static interface |
CreatePartnerEventSourceRequest.Builder |
Modifier and Type | Method and Description |
---|---|
String |
account()
The Amazon Web Services account ID that is permitted to create a matching partner event bus for this partner
event source.
|
static CreatePartnerEventSourceRequest.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
String |
name()
The name of the partner event source.
|
List<SdkField<?>> |
sdkFields() |
static Class<? extends CreatePartnerEventSourceRequest.Builder> |
serializableBuilderClass() |
CreatePartnerEventSourceRequest.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
overrideConfiguration
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
copy
public final String name()
The name of the partner event source. This name must be unique and must be in the format
partner_name/event_namespace/event_name
. The Amazon Web Services account that
wants to use this partner event source must create a partner event bus with a name that matches the name of the
partner event source.
partner_name/event_namespace/event_name
. The Amazon Web Services
account that wants to use this partner event source must create a partner event bus with a name that
matches the name of the partner event source.public final String account()
The Amazon Web Services account ID that is permitted to create a matching partner event bus for this partner event source.
public CreatePartnerEventSourceRequest.Builder toBuilder()
toBuilder
in interface ToCopyableBuilder<CreatePartnerEventSourceRequest.Builder,CreatePartnerEventSourceRequest>
toBuilder
in class EventBridgeRequest
public static CreatePartnerEventSourceRequest.Builder builder()
public static Class<? extends CreatePartnerEventSourceRequest.Builder> serializableBuilderClass()
public final int hashCode()
hashCode
in class AwsRequest
public final boolean equals(Object obj)
equals
in class AwsRequest
public final boolean equalsBySdkFields(Object obj)
equalsBySdkFields
in interface SdkPojo
public final String toString()
public final <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
getValueForField
in class SdkRequest
Copyright © 2022. All rights reserved.